Selflove--Paige


 With this month being February and Valentine's Day just passing,I feel as if it's necessary to have the topic of love. During this month it could either be a really good time or a very sad one during Valentine's time it's no in between. On one hand we have the people with their significant others and on the other hand not so much but feel as if they do need someone to spend quality time with just for the holiday. I'm not talking about all just a general statement from what I hear around. Personally the concept of love is not just for one holiday and gifts but to actually reflect on why you love that someone/something. It’s not all about having someone yeah It’s nice to be with someone but take into consideration we are young we have plenty of time to find someone. Maybe later in life you will find the one youre destined to be with as of for now enjoy yourself. So here is when selflove comes into play, since it’s the time of year to love and be loved why don’t you reflect on why you love yourself. Some of you are probably thinking this sounds a little selfish, self absorbed way of thinking having that mentality, meanwhile it's just showing appreciation to yourself once in awhile. We all are very busy,stressing or even at this point the feeling of not caring at all so why not tend to yourself occasionally. With being a high school student i have found myself very Selfless putting school first, staying up late, making myself more stressed than I should be assignments and more assignments due it’s been a rough couple years aha. Whereas now I came to the point where I’m learning to balance myself and school. It is important to find balance, having your inner sanity controlled. Selflove is to reflect on what things you do good, what you have accomplished, what things make you genuinely happy even if it's treating yourself to something you feel you deserve go out and do so. Putting yourself in a more positive place and state of mind gives you an imaginable feeling and it's great to see your self worth. Falling in love with the person you are or hope to become is overall selflove. Putting yourself first is selflove and most importantly obtaining happiness is selflove. Coming to the actualization of the idea of love and loving yourself is an essential key to life.Reflecting back on this month personally with having selflove seeing what I have going for myself and the actual being in love with who I am as a person makes me so much happier and content with life at the moment. So the next time February comes around don’t dread it as much love is in the air even if it’s just for yourself. Not even just the month of February but all year round take some time for yourself and reflect how you can have selflove.
